Step 13

Allow your paint to dry completely before moving on.

Step 14

Bake your cup in the over according to the tutorial on Delicious and DIY.

Tips:

  • Although she doesn’t say this, I put my cup in the cold oven while it pre-heated. I worried that putting a cold cup (it is winter, after all) in a hot oven would make it crack.
  • After the timer went off, I turned off the oven and cracked the door. This allowed the cup to cool down slowly, again to prevent it from cracking.

Step 12

After putting on protective gloves, cover your design with etching solution.

Step 13

Let the etching solution set the amount of time recommended on the packaging.

 

This DIY etched family Mickey plate is such an easy and inexpensive gift that any Disney fan would love to receive. It is also the perfect way to surprise kids with a Disney vacation announcement.

Step 14

Next, put your protective gloves on and rinse the etching solution off of your plate and remove your tape.
